Short-Term Rental Regulations in Unincorporated Areas of Los Angeles County, Relevant to Venice Beach, California for 2024
While Venice Beach is part of the City of Los Angeles, the regulations for unincorporated areas of Los Angeles County provide a comprehensive overview of the general framework that may influence or be similar to those in incorporated areas like Venice Beach. Here are the key regulations:
Registration and Primary Residence
- Hosts must register their primary residence with the county and pay an annual fee of $914.
Primary Residence Requirement
- Short-term rentals are limited to hosts who are renting out their primary residence, where they live for at least 275 days per calendar year.
Rental Duration Limits
- Properties can be rented for no more than 30 consecutive days at a time, with a maximum of 90 nights per calendar year without a host present overnight.
Guest Occupancy Limits
- Maximum occupancy is limited to 2 persons per bedroom, plus two, with a total maximum of 12 persons per guest booking.
Prohibited Properties
- Second homes, guesthouses, accessory dwelling units (ADUs), investment properties, and properties subject to rent stabilization or affordable housing restrictions are prohibited from being listed as short-term rentals.
Corporate Hosts
- “Corporate hosts” who rent out multiple properties are prohibited from listing these properties.
Enforcement
- The county is developing an enforcement arm with penalties for non-compliance, although the specifics of the penalties are still being finalized.
Additional Restrictions
- No short-term rentals are allowed in motor homes, cars, boats, temporary or semi-permanent structures, or units subject to rental caps or affordable housing restrictions.
These regulations aim to balance the economic benefits of short-term rentals with the need to preserve long-term housing stock and maintain the character of residential neighborhoods.

Discovering Venice Beach, California: Local Attractions and Insider Tips
Must-Visit Attractions
Venice Beach Boardwalk
- This iconic boardwalk is a hub for people watching, street performers, artists, and unique shops. It's a vibrant promenade that offers something for everyone[5|.
- Play "Boardwalk Bingo" to check off quirky sights like buff workout leaders, marijuana doctors, and street artists.
Muscle Beach
- The birthplace of the American fitness boom, Muscle Beach is an outdoor gym where you can work out with day passes available. It's a spot famous for its association with Arnold Schwarzenegger and Lou Ferrigno.
Venice Beach Skatepark
- Located at 1800 Ocean Front Walk, this skatepark is a hotspot for professional and amateur skaters. It features state-of-the-art bowls and contours and is open from 9 a.m. to sunset.
Venice Beach Pier
- A 1,300-foot walking path connected to the Pacific Ocean, the pier offers stunning ocean views, live entertainment, and a lively beach scene with sunbathers, volleyball players, and food trucks.
Venice Wall Art
- The Venice Art Walls showcase rotating collections of street art, murals, and graffiti. Located at Ocean Front Walk, it attracts millions of visitors each year.
Historic Venice Canals
- Take a stroll through the picturesque Venice Canals, which feature arching pedestrian bridges, charming beach houses, and a serene atmosphere. You can also bring your own non-motorized vessel to explore the canals.
Insider Tips
Bike Rentals
- Rent bikes, electric scooters, skateboards, or rollerblades to explore the 2-mile Venice Beach Boardwalk and the 22-mile Strand Bike Path that extends along the coast.
Mural & Street Art Tour
- Join a guided tour to explore the epic Venice Street Art scene and learn about the talented artists behind the murals and graffiti.
Abbot Kinney Blvd.
- Known as "the coolest block in America," this shopping district offers an eclectic mix of shops, live music, and local promotions, especially during First Friday events.
Venice Beach Recreation Center
- This center includes facilities for surfing, volleyball, basketball, paddle tennis, and more. It's also home to the famous outdoor basketball courts featured in the film White Men Can’t Jump.
Venice Beach Drum Circle
- On Saturdays and Sundays, join the improvisational drum circle on the sand at Brooks Avenue and Ocean Front Walk. This free event is open to all ages and features drums, shakers, and dancing.

Practical Tips for Running a Successful Short-Term Rental in Venice Beach, California
To successfully manage a short-term rental in Venice Beach, California, hosts should prioritize compliance with local regulations and enhance guest experiences. Noise regulations are crucial; informing guests about quiet hours, typically from 10 PM to 7 AM, helps maintain neighborhood peace and avoids potential fines. Creating a detailed house manual, available in both digital and physical formats, can provide guests with essential information such as instructions, Wi-Fi passwords, and local attractions. Additionally, implementing a simplified check-in process using smart locks can streamline arrivals, while providing clear parking instructions with accompanying photos will assist guests in navigating the property easily. By focusing on these practical tips, hosts can create a welcoming environment that encourages positive reviews and repeat bookings.

Understanding Short-Term Rental Management Fees in Venice Beach, California
In Venice Beach, California, short-term rental management fees typically range from 10% to 30% of rental revenue, depending on the level of service provided. Full-service management options—including guest communication, marketing, and maintenance—generally fall at the higher end of this spectrum, while basic management services may be more economical. Additionally, hosts should be aware that extra fees for cleaning, repairs, or design services may also apply. Given the area's strict regulations regarding short-term rentals, including the requirement for permits and adherence to local ordinances, understanding these management fees is essential for hosts looking to navigate the competitive rental landscape effectively while maximizing their investment returns.
